Optilink branded instrument is an Optical Network Terminal or ONT, which is necessary if you have to get an FTTH connection, it does the work of media conversion from optical to electrical. On top of this you ca buy any normal router like Archer C6, and bridge the ONT to this router for a good performance. Or you can simply use the ONT itself as a router, because it is a combo device. But most ONTs a have 2.4g band Wifi only, so you can buy a cheaper ONT and bridge it to TP-LinkArcher C6 for good performance
You can access internet with Optilink ONT but do not require Archer C6, but not viceversa
